让我先说一下我的问题:我对 Debian/Linux 完全陌生。我第一次涉足 Linux 时情况并不顺利,如果有任何帮助,我将不胜感激!
我正在尝试将 Debian 8 与现有的 Windows 7 一起安装。以下是到目前为止我已完成的步骤:
从下载“debian-8.7.1-amd64-CD-1.iso.torrent”这里并使用 win32diskimager 创建了可启动 USB 闪存驱动器。
从闪存驱动器启动并使用 Debian 安装程序对 Windows 进行重新分区——我将 250GB SSD 的大约 150GB 分配给了 Windows。然后我让 Debian 安装程序自动配置我释放的 80GB。它创建了一个 3.3GB 的交换分区和一个 ~75GB 的分区,我认为这是用于 Debian 的所有东西。
完成图形安装程序中的其余步骤,例如选择帐户名和桌面环境;让它安装grub。
当我最终完成并第一次尝试启动 Debian 时,grub 出现了,但只列出了 Debian 而不是 Windows。此外,当我选择 Debian 时,它会挂在屏幕上,上面简单地写着:
加载请稍候...
/dev/sda5:干净,104994/4685824 个文件,1170977/18716672 个块
我真的不知道如何从这里继续。我做了一些搜索并找到了确保启用传统启动并禁用快速启动的建议,但当我检查 BIOS 设置时发现这些已经是这种情况。
答案1
强烈建议您使用 Stretch RC3 安装程序 - 它将在短时间内成为新的稳定版本,并且几乎坚如磐石,是我的日常驱动程序。它可以在这里找到,包括固件,强烈推荐给刚接触 Linux 的人,特别是 Debian 的人。https://cdimage.debian.org/cdimage/unofficial/non-free/cd-include-firmware/stretch_di_rc3/
显然,请选择适合您的架构的一款。还有什么问题,就喊吧!
答案2
重新启动系统,当 grub 菜单出现时,按e编辑 grub。然后求ro quiet
e,g:
linux /vmlinuz-3.13-1-amd64 root=/dev/mapper/root-root init=/bin/systemd ro quiet
并将其更改为ro nomodeset quiet
然后按Ctrl+X启动。
打开nano /etc/default/grub
然后更改以下行:
GRUB_CMDLINE_LINUX_DEFAULT="ro quiet"
到:
GRUB_CMDLINE_LINUX_DEFAULT="ro nomodeset quiet"
保存文件,退出并更新 Grub:
update-grub